Celebrating its 90-year anniversary, Gallatin’s historical event center announces a grand reopening of their improved space, ideal for weddings, concerts and corporate functions.

Originally built in 1926 by Sloan Distributing Co., the Depot Square Event Space primarily functioned as a dry goods distribution center. The building has since been renovated, offering 9,800 square feet of space and featuring Gallatin’s largest dance floor at 1,400 square feet.

Depot Square Event Space provides open seating for up to 500 guests with graveled parking for an estimated 400 vehicles and trailers. Additional improvements include a revamped upstairs lounge, fresh carpeting, and renovated restrooms.

Since the 1980s the owners have used the space for manufacturing, crafts and hobby space, professional offices and an event center. Several Depot events have included performances from Grand Opry friends, performers and song writers as well as the Gallatin Cowboy Church.

The historic building was constructed with unique metal roof trusses, shipped from Bethlehem Steel Works in West Virginia. The concrete support columns and exterior wall framing techniques lend a rustic feel. The back warehouse currently houses office space for CDF Distributors, an online supplier of commercial doors.
